What is the car wash consolidation opportunity in San Antonio?
The San Antonio market structures the rollup question around three signals: top-operator share, independent acquisition pipeline, and format-disruption opportunity. With 1,646 locations total, the metro reads as a large market for this analysis.

Independent share runs at 85% (1,395 of 1,646 sites) — a fragmented-supply market with a deep tuck-in acquisition pipeline.
Format mix in San Antonio is led by express tunnel (140 sites, 49% of classified inventory) with detail shop second (110 sites, 38%).
